技术文摘
如何导出 MySQL 数据库数据
如何导出MySQL数据库数据
在MySQL数据库管理中,导出数据是一项常见且重要的操作。无论是为了数据备份、迁移,还是用于数据分析等其他用途,掌握正确的数据导出方法都至关重要。下面就为大家详细介绍几种常见的导出MySQL数据库数据的方式。
使用命令行工具导出
MySQL自带的命令行工具是导出数据的常用方式之一。打开命令提示符或终端窗口,确保已经正确配置了MySQL环境变量。然后,使用以下命令进行数据导出:
mysqldump -u用户名 -p密码 数据库名 > 导出文件名.sql
在这个命令中,“用户名”和“密码”是你登录MySQL数据库的凭证,“数据库名”为要导出数据的数据库名称,“导出文件名.sql”是指定导出文件的名称和格式。例如:
mysqldump -uroot -p123456 mydatabase > mydata.sql
执行该命令后,系统会提示输入密码,输入正确密码后,MySQL数据库中的数据就会被导出到指定的文件中。这种方式适用于导出整个数据库的数据,简单快捷。
使用图形化工具导出
对于不熟悉命令行操作的用户,图形化工具是个不错的选择。比如MySQL Workbench,这是一款功能强大的数据库管理工具。打开MySQL Workbench并连接到目标数据库,在左侧导航栏中右键点击要导出的数据库,选择“Table Data Export Wizard”。按照向导提示进行操作,选择要导出的数据表,设置导出文件的路径和格式等参数,最后点击“Finish”即可完成数据导出。
使用SQL语句导出
除了上述两种方法,还可以通过SQL语句来导出数据。例如,使用“SELECT... INTO OUTFILE”语句可以将查询结果导出到文件中。语法如下:
SELECT * INTO OUTFILE '文件路径'
FIELDS TERMINATED BY ','
ENCLOSED BY '"'
LINES TERMINATED BY '\n'
FROM 表名;
其中,“文件路径”指定导出文件的存储位置,“FIELDS TERMINATED BY”定义字段之间的分隔符,“ENCLOSED BY”指定字段的包围字符,“LINES TERMINATED BY”指定行的结束符,“表名”是要导出数据的表。这种方法适用于导出特定查询结果的数据。
掌握以上几种导出MySQL数据库数据的方法,能够满足不同场景下的数据导出需求,帮助你更高效地管理和利用数据库中的数据。无论是进行日常备份,还是为项目迁移做准备,这些方法都能发挥重要作用。
TAGS: 数据导出 MySQL数据库 导出工具 MySQL数据库数据导出
- 2023 年 Vue 开发者的 React 学习之路
- 利用 LangChain 大语言模型集成工具打造个人论文汇总与查询工具
- 十五周快慢指针算法训练营
- 这款神器值得推荐:有时超越 GPT4.0
- JavaScript 中的四种枚举形式
- GitHub Copilot X:基于 GPT-4 的全新智能编程帮手
- 美团面试官把我榨干了!
- Java 打造简单故事书的手把手教程
- 利用 CSS MASK 打造 Loading 效果
- 前端面试:CSS3 的 Flexbox(弹性盒布局模型)解析
- 前端开发必知:Maps 和 WeakMaps 在 DOM 节点管理中的奇妙应用
- 七个 Web 开发人员可用的资源
- Apache Iceberg 引入索引优化查询性能
- 策略设计模式全解析
- 六个实用的 JavaScript 代码片段